WebJun 24, 2024 · The footings for porch decks must be larger than deck footings. Many porches use 22″ + diameter corner and intermediate footings. Gable end porches will also require an additional footing in the center of the side rim to transfer the truss or rafter loads to the footings because the framing of the roof is perpendicular to the floor framing.WebThis is called the tributary load. If you multiply the area of this section 5’ x 5’, you will get 25 square feet. You can multiply this area by 55 lbs per square foot loading to come up with 1,375 lbs total load. Once you know the total load, you can use the chart below to determine the footing size for your soil conditions.

WebSection R507 describes criteria for designing exterior decks. Decks shall be designed for the live load required in Section R301.5 or the ground snow load indicated in Table R301.2, whichever is greater. Section R507.3.3 describes methods to protect deck footing from frost in instances where decks are attached to a frost-protected structure.WebThe under-deck space can also be used as a shaded play area for kids.
